项目地址

GitHub 原项目地址:https://github.com/icret/EasyImages2.0

Docker 镜像:https://ddsderek/easyimage:latest

搭建环境

  • 系统:Debian 10

  • 域名解析一枚:img.linrol.eu.org

  • 提前安装好安装好 Docker、Docker-compose

搭建实操

编写docker-compose.yml 文件

version: '3'
services:
  easyimage:
    image: ddsderek/easyimage:latest
    container_name: easyimage
    ports:
      - '8080:80'
    environment:
      - TZ=Asia/Shanghai
      - PUID=1000
      - PGID=1000
    volumes:
      - '/root/data/easyimage/data/config:/app/web/config'
      - '/root/data/easyimage/data/i:/app/web/i'
    restart: unless-stopped

启动docker服务

docker-compose up -d 

配置nginx代理

location / {
    proxy_pass http://127.0.0.1:8080;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Real-PORT $remote_port;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_set_header Host $http_host;
    proxy_set_header Scheme $scheme;
    proxy_set_header Server-Protocol $server_protocol;
    proxy_set_header Server-Name $server_name;
    proxy_set_header Server-Addr $server_addr;
    proxy_set_header Server-Port $server_port;
}

效果展示

访问链接:https://img.linrol.eu.org